Briefly, PPR is a type of polypropylene plastic pipe that has some advantages over other plastic pipe used in residential and commercial plumbing (e.g. PVC and CVPC). The main advantages are stability, durability (up to 50 years) and leak resistance. Downsides are cost and need for specialized tools for making joints (the pipe is joined using a heat fusion welding rather than glues as for PVC pipes).
